a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--libstdc++-v3/ChangeLog6
-rw-r--r--libstdc++-v3/bits/valarray_array.h4
2 files changed, 8 insertions, 2 deletions
diff --git a/libstdc++-v3/ChangeLog b/libstdc++-v3/ChangeLog
index ac431c8..438a592 100644
--- a/libstdc++-v3/ChangeLog
+++ b/libstdc++-v3/ChangeLog
@@ -1,3 +1,9 @@
+2000-08-19 Gabriel Dos Reis <gdr@codesourcery.com>
+
+ * bits/valarray_array.h (__valarray_min, __valarray_max): Fix
+ thinko. Diagnostic messages really need to be improved for
+ template argument deduction.
+
2000-08-18 Benjamin Kosnik <bkoz@gnu.org>
* bits/valarray_meta.h: Fix typos...
diff --git a/libstdc++-v3/bits/valarray_array.h b/libstdc++-v3/bits/valarray_array.h
index de8a3bf..2c88877 100644
--- a/libstdc++-v3/bits/valarray_array.h
+++ b/libstdc++-v3/bits/valarray_array.h
@@ -296,7 +296,7 @@ namespace std
// Compute the min/max of an array-expression
template<typename _Ta>
- inline typename _Ta::value_array
+ inline typename _Ta::value_type
__valarray_min(const _Ta& __a)
{
size_t __s = __a.size();
@@ -312,7 +312,7 @@ namespace std
}
template<typename _Ta>
- inline typename _Ta::value_array
+ inline typename _Ta::value_type
__valarray_max(const _Ta& __a)
{
size_t __s = __a.size();